Plex Releases Critical Security Patches for Multiple Undisclosed Vulnerabilities

Plex has released critical security patches in versions 1.43.3 and 1.115.0 to address multiple undisclosed vulnerabilities, urging users to update immediately. Previous flaws, such as CVE-2025-34158, exposed administrative tokens and infrastructure, highlighting the risks of delayed updates.

Plex is urging users to update their instances to the latest version following the release of an update that patches multiple security flaws.

The fixes are available in Plex Media Server 1.43.3 and Plex Desktop 1.115.0. The streaming media service did not elaborate on what those issues are, but said CVE identifiers have been requested for them.
